Which pair of constructions would require the same steps? a congruent line segment and an angle congruent to a given angle a pair of perpendicular lines and a bisector of a line segment a pair of parallel lines and an angle bisector a bisector of an angle and a bisector of a given line segment

OpenStudy (aripotta):

b, i think. a perpendicular line makes a 90 degree angle with another line. a bisector makes a 90 degree angle with another line as well, but also cutting the line in half
